The handheld gaming market is growing fast with several available options from Ayaneo, Valve, ASUS and most recently Lenovo all offering similar devices with their own quirks and differences. More competition in a market is always great making the news of MSI joining the handheld market with their MSI “Claw”, a very nice thought.
The images for the MSI Claw Gaming Handheld were shared on Twitter/X by wxnod (Via TPU) in a leaked promotional image with the date of 2024. The handheld itself is nothing we haven’t already seen in the competition but shares much of its “gamer” design language with the ROG Ally including the RGB joysticks. The controls also follow the same layout as the competition which is great for comfort and uniformity. There isn’t much else to decipher from the image though I’d suspect more information will be revealed at CES 2024 on January 9th-12th.
